Qian Daoliu, revered and wise for a lifetime, had made one mistake—he was far too indulgent with Qian Xunji.

Because of this, he carried a sense of guilt deep within.

Of course, Bibi Dong had already killed Qian Xunji. As Qian Xunji's father and Qian Renxue's grandfather, Qian Daoliu chose not to seek revenge, seeing this as a way to atone for his guilt.

Qian Daoliu understood why Qian Xunji had met his end. When he pursued Tang Hao, it was only a half-hearted effort.

Tang Hao, however, believed he had escaped thanks to the Exploding Ring technique and the Great Sumeru Hammer.

How laughable!

What kind of existence was Qian Daoliu?

Even Tang Hao's grandfather, Tang Chen, a Limit Douluo at rank 99, could only match him evenly. In aerial combat, Tang Chen was not his equal.

Of course, on land, the tables turned—Qian Daoliu wasn't a match for Tang Chen.

The Great Sumeru Hammer and Exploding Ring techniques were Tang Chen's own innovations.

Tang Hao, a newly advanced Titled Douluo, severely injured no less, could never have truly escaped Qian Daoliu's grasp if he had been serious!

That aside, for Qian Renxue to ultimately ascend as the new Angelic God, someone needed to make a sacrifice.

That person had to be Qian Daoliu himself.

Only through his sacrifice could his spirit power activate the ninth trial of the Angelic Nine Trials, enabling her ascension.

This meant that, in the end, he would have to leave Qian Renxue.

In the future, the only people who would accompany her were Kong and her mother, Bibi Dong.

Bibi Dong, too, was a godly inheritor—something Qian Daoliu was fully aware of.

And if one day, Qian Renxue learned the truth...

"Old Man, please speak. If it's within our power, we'll do it."

Hearing this, Qian Daoliu waved his hand and said with a calm expression, "Kong, this matter is incredibly simple for you. It won't trouble you in the slightest!"

"You must promise me that no matter what, this must remain a secret from Xiao Xue!"

"Alright, I promise you! I swear on the honor of the Blue Lightning Tyrant Dragon Clan!"

Without hesitation, Kong raised his hand and solemnly declared.

"..."

Qian Daoliu's eye twitched. The honor of the Blue Lightning Tyrant Dragon Clan?

Your martial soul isn't even the Blue Lightning Tyrant Dragon!

Shaking his head, he decided not to dwell on it.

"As a godly inheritor, I may not know exactly how you'll acquire your divine seat, but it surely won't be simple."

Kong listened silently, though his expression turned a bit odd. Not simple?

It didn't seem all that difficult to him!

Whether or not he gained a divine seat hardly mattered. With his current combat strength, a divine seat was merely the icing on the cake.

Even something as formidable as the Asura God's divine seat offered only limited enhancement to his power, let alone others.

Besides, after inheriting the Asura God's legacy, he hadn't encountered anything particularly complicated...

Without noticing Kong's subtle reaction, Qian Daoliu continued, "The Angelic God's divine seat descends in the form of nine trials. During the final trial..."

At this point, Qian Daoliu paused briefly before continuing, "I will have to leave Xiao Xue. In the days to come, only you will remain by her side."

Kong showed no particular reaction—this was something he had known for a long time.

Whether it was the Sea God's inheritance or the Angelic God's, both required the Grand Worshipper's sacrifice to initiate the trials.

This had always puzzled Kong. Why was this necessary?

In the original work, Oscar and Ning Rongrong also inherited divine seats. Neither of their gods had a Grand Worshipper in Douluo Continent, yet they still became gods.

Inheriting a divine seat shouldn't require such a sacrifice.

If the Angelic God was already deceased, and the Grand Worshipper's sacrifice to initiate the inheritance was a last resort, then what about Poseidon, the Sea God?

Why would a deity like Poseidon also require their followers or descendants to make sacrifices?

In the original story, whether it was spirit beasts or humans, they were either sacrificing themselves or on their way to being sacrificed. This pattern was bizarre, to say the least.

Seeing Kong's unchanged expression, Qian Daoliu pondered. It seemed Kong was already aware of this matter.

"Bibi Dong, the current Pope, is also a godly inheritor. Moreover, she is Xiao Xue's mother."

"If—if one day they find themselves at odds, I hope you can stop them."

After saying this, Qian Daoliu took a deep breath.

From what he knew about Bibi Dong, she would never harm Xiao Xue.

But conflicts could arise, and if they escalated, he feared they might turn their weapons against each other.

This was something Qian Daoliu did not want to see.

After all, they were mother and daughter!

Hearing this, Kong suddenly understood.

It turned out Qian Daoliu was worried that after his passing, there would be no one to mediate between Qian Renxue and Bibi Dong.

Both Qian Renxue and Bibi Dong had strong, unyielding personalities. If a conflict did arise, it might indeed lead to a serious fight!

The decisions of gods were often akin to fate.

If Qian Renxue and Bibi Dong were to truly clash, not even someone like Golden Crocodile Douluo could intervene.

Only another godly presence could stop and mediate between them.

Judging by Kong's demeanor, Qian Daoliu, though reluctant to admit it, had to acknowledge that Kong's inheritance might surpass that of the Angelic God.

As the Grand Worshipper of the Angelic God, such thoughts felt inappropriate. Yet, Qian Daoliu could not help but believe it.

After his "century" passed, Kong would likely be the only one capable of mediating between the two gods.

"Old Man, if my mother-in-law ever dares to attack my wife, I absolutely won't allow it!"

Hearing this, Qian Daoliu smiled in satisfaction. Kong had agreed!

He was very pleased with Kong's response.

What puzzled him, however, was whether Kong already knew about the conflict between Xiao Xue and Bibi Dong.

Otherwise, why wouldn't he question why a mother and daughter who both became gods might end up fighting?

"With you by Xiao Xue's side, I can rest in peace after I'm gone."

"Tang Chen, oh Tang Chen, my greatest regret in life is never having defeated you. But my descendants will surpass yours!"

"In the end, I still win!"

The great regret of the Douluo Continent—the battle between Qian Daoliu and Tang Chen—remained lightly touched upon.

The Sword and Bone Douluos sacrificed their lives to save Tang San.

After chatting with Qian Daoliu about various topics, Kong finally bid him farewell and exited the Worship Hall.

To Qian Daoliu, it didn't matter how many women Kong had. A hundred years, a thousand years later, the only one by his side would be Qian Renxue.

The lifespan of a god was beyond the imagination of ordinary people, making such concerns trivial.

This was why Qian Daoliu never mentioned the number of women around Kong, as long as he treated Qian Renxue well.

Qian Daoliu: Have a broader perspective!

After leaving the Worship Hall, Kong began retracing his steps. The knight guards stationed there acted as if they hadn't seen him, allowing him to move freely.

After all, this was someone who had entered the Worship Hall alongside the Second Worshipper. How could mere knight guards dare to interfere with him?
